It had to be something Birdman said during his appearance on ESPN's Highly Questionable on Tuesday, June 28, that was suspect to Lil Wayne; unless it was his mere presence, as the Cash Money rapper took to social media to stiff his estranged boss after the interview.

“Highly questionable is hiiiiiighly questionable today,” tweeted Wayne.

The continual strain of their once mutually recognized father-son relationship is a thing of little secret in hip-hop for the past couple of years. Their failure to reconcile was magnified back in April when during his infamous interview on The Breakfast Club, Birdman was confronted with a perfect storm of ridicule for being quick to target Charlamagne for comments he made, yet abstaining from seeking out rappers including Trick Daddy for criticisms they had of him. Soon after the interview, Wayne put out a photo of himself standing with Trick Daddy, and since that time has been recorded inviting the crowd at his shows to say it together with him as he yells out "F*** Cash Money."
